PixaSmith for macOS
Extract, compress, and convert document images with a focused local workflow. PixaSmith keeps source files unchanged and saves results where you choose.
Supported workflows
Format availability follows the media capabilities included with your version of macOS.
Export embedded images from office documents. Image-only PDFs preserve eligible image data; composed PDF pages export as complete PNG images.
Reduce eligible images inside documents or compress up to 1,000 standalone images while preserving pixel dimensions.
Convert common raster images, export PDF pages as images, or combine ordered images into a PDF.
Quick start
Open Extract Images, Compress File, or Format Converter from the sidebar.
Choose files in Finder or drag them into the source area, then select an output folder.
Set the available quality or format options, inspect the summary, and start processing.

No. Document and image processing runs locally on your Mac. PixaSmith does not require an account and does not include analytics.
No. Extracted, compressed, and converted results are written to the output folder you choose. Source files remain unchanged.
PixaSmith publishes a compressed copy only when it is meaningfully smaller and passes the selected visual-quality checks. Already-efficient files can finish without a new copy.
Yes. Image compression accepts up to 1,000 JPEG, PNG, TIFF, or HEIC files in one batch and continues past unsupported or already-efficient items.
Image-only PDFs preserve eligible embedded images. Pages containing text, vectors, gradients, or other composed artwork export as complete rendered PNG files.
Encrypted, password-protected, digitally signed, structurally damaged, and repair-dependent documents are declined to protect document integrity.
